CM 1115 - Commercial and Residential Building Codes

Institution:
Central New Mexico Community College
Subject:
Description:
Through exercises and lecture students will become familiar with model building codes, the project manual/ specifications and zoning and planning codes. Students will investigate how they affect and govern the construction process.
